GA213 & GA215 Sound Pressure Level Meters 'A' and 'C' frequency weighting (toggle) 'Slow' and 'Fast' Time constants (toggle) Sound Pressure (Lp) to 0.1dB resolution Lmax - maximum Lp hold (rms) Pmax - maximum peak level Elapsed time (running time hrs, min, sec) Overload and Under-range indication Housed in a tough, crack resistant ABS plastic Battery condition (life approx. 24 hours) GA213 Sound Level Meter: A simple-to-use instrument that is fully compliant with IEC 61672-1:2002 Class 2 and IEC 60651:1979 Type 2. This is a necessary requirement for carrying out most noise assessment tasks in industry. Simultaneous rms and peak measurement Designed for use by Industrial Safety Officers, Occupational Nurses and Engineers for general survey use in health and safety and engineering applications. Gives clear results to International standards requirements Simultaneous measurement of Lp, Lmax, and Pmax GA215 Integrating Sound Level Meter: A feature packed instrument that is fully compliant with IEC 61672-1:2002 Class 2, IEC 60651: 1979 Type 2 and IEC 60804: 2001 Type 2. This meter gives simultaneous Leq (rms. average) and peak measurement for assessments to the Noise at Work Regulations 1989 and general engineering applications. Designed for Industrial Safety Officers, Safety Managers and Engineers for compliance with the Health and Safety as Work Act; Noise at Work regulation 1989. Will provide necessary information for completing risk assessments Integrated equivalent level (Leq) measurement Personal Sound Exposure Level (Lex) was Lep'd Simultaneous measurement of Lp, Leq, Lmax and Pmax Note: For compliance with the Noise at Work regulations and relevant international standards, sound level meters should be calibrated before use and checked afterwards.
